They are brought on by bits of healthy protein and other tissue that are embedded in the clear, gel-like material (called glasslike) which loads the within of our eye. As we age the glasslike ends up being more liquid, making the bits of protein and other cells a lot more obvious. Some floaters (specifically those come with by flashes of light) may indicate an extremely significant problem, such as a separated retina.

Make an emergency situation visit with your eye physician or proceed to the local emergency clinic. Many retinal detachments can be repaired if they are treated quickly, but if they are not treated in time you might experience a loss of vision and even loss of sight. The retina is the thin layer of tissue that lines the inner part of the back of the eyeball. Its duty is to receive light and send visual signals to the mind.

Glaucoma is an eye condition that can cause irreparable vision loss. It takes place when liquid builds up within the eye. The excess liquid places pressure on delicate retinal nerve fibers, causing damage to the optic nerve. Without therapy, this can create an individual to considerably shed their field of vision.
